152. Deputy Duncan Smith asked the Minister for Children, Equality, Disability, Integration and Youth the number of creche workers supervising children who do not hold qualifications; how many non-compliance issues relating to unqualified workers in creches have not been addressed through the Corrective and Preventative Action process by TUSLA to date;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[21912/23]
